CATHENA model of a shield circuit for ITER (v.1)

Abstract

This report contains the description of the CATHENA network model of a shield circuit for the ITER (International Thermo-nuclear Experimental Reactor) heat transport system. The model has been tested to demonstrate its ability to simulate the thermalhydraulic behaviour of such a loop during both steady-state operation and transient conditions. The CATHENA code is a general two-fluid thermalhydraulic code. The report also presents the circuit conditions during steady state operation and documents two loss-of-coolant scenarios simulated with the model. A description of the thermalhydraulic behaviour of the circuit as it empties is provided. (Author) (21 figs., tab., 12 refs.).
